As South African families gear up for the summer holiday travel season, Nissan South Africa is urging drivers to prioritise vehicle safety before hitting the road. To support safe and stress-free journeys, Nissan is offering a dedicated Summer Vehicle Health Check, available at authorised dealers until 31 January, for just R199.

“Increased travel volume, heavier vehicle loads, and long-distance driving during the holidays make professional inspections critical to preventing breakdowns and accidents,” said Freddie Louw, General Manager: Aftersales South Africa & Sub Sahara Africa at Nissan Motor Corporation.

Nissan’s health check covers essential components such as brakes, tyres, suspension, battery, lights, and fluids, ensuring every system functions optimally. “A summer holiday trip should be worry-free. A safety check by a certified Nissan technician not only minimises the chance of roadside breakdowns but also keeps your family safe throughout the journey,” Louw added.

Expertise You Can Trust
Authorised Nissan dealers employ factory-trained technicians who understand every Nissan model inside out. Their specialised knowledge allows them to identify potential issues that often go unnoticed, addressing them before they become hazards.

Using genuine manufacturer-approved parts, dealers ensure that all repairs meet strict safety and performance standards, reducing the risk of component failure during long-distance travel.

“Modern vehicles rely heavily on electronics and integrated safety systems. Nissan Service Centres use diagnostic equipment specifically designed for your vehicle, allowing them to detect hidden faults and calibrate safety features such as ABS, airbags, and driver-assist systems,” Louw explained.

Warranty Protection and Peace of Mind
Having your vehicle inspected and serviced at an authorised dealer also safeguards your warranty and service plan coverage, something essential for travellers who want to avoid surprises during holiday emergencies.

With peak summer travel fast approaching, appointment slots at Nissan dealers fill quickly. Drivers are encouraged to schedule their pre-trip inspections early to ensure availability.

“When you choose us to take care of your Nissan, you choose the best value from a team you can trust,” Louw said. “With an extensive dealer network across South Africa and neighbouring countries, Nissan owners can travel with confidence, knowing their vehicle is in safe hands this holiday season.”
